Tips For Small Scale Success


Drs. Foster & Smith Educational Staff
Tips For Small Scale Success
Homeowners new to pond-keeping may be inclined to start with a small fish pond. However, small fish ponds, less than 1,000 gallons, can present a greater challenge. For small fish pond success, pay special attention to water quality, stocking level, and oxygen levels.

Monitor and maintain water quality
A smaller fish pond may seem easier to maintain. After all, less water means less work, right? Contrary to this logic, a small fish pond may involve more maintenance if important water parameters are not monitored carefully and kept within acceptable levels. Due to their smaller water volume, small fish ponds are more susceptible to the potentially harmful effects of poor water quality. A large volume of water dilutes toxins and the effects of such harmful chemicals as ammonia and nitrite.

However, when water-quality issues occur in small ponds, harmful chemicals can quickly rise to toxic levels, placing great stress on pond fish and the entire pond ecosystem. A reliable master pond test kit and scheduled routine maintenance is essential for all ponds, especially smaller ponds. Also, be sure to routinely monitor pond water temperature. A smaller pond is subject to greater change in temperature since it is easier to heat or cool a smaller volume of water. Less water means less stable temperatures and that means more stress to pond fish. A floating pond thermometer is an inexpensive tool that provides vital information regarding your pond environment.

Koi are considered the quintessential pond fish. However, they may not be the ideal choice for small fish ponds. Koi require a pond with at least 1,000 gallons of water, and under ideal conditions, these beautiful fish can grow to a length of 36 inches! When choosing fish for your pond, always consider the adult or maximum size of the species you are interested in. If you have a small pond, resist the purchase of young, juvenile koi or comets. Though cute and seemingly manageable, comets can grow over 12 inches in length and can quickly crowd a small pond. Instead, consider Ornamental or Fancy Goldfish. They are excellent alternatives to koi and are better suited for smaller fish ponds. Keep in mind that most well-maintained ponds will support roughly 1 inch of adult fish per ten gallons of water.

Oxygenate small ponds
Similar to water quality, pond oxygen level is influenced by water volume - more precisely, the water surface where gas exchange occurs. A pond with a small water surface area can experience poor gas exchange. Without proper gas exchange to replenish oxygen, a series of negative events can occur including fish stress and compromised biological filtration. Install an aeration device or a water fountain kit to enhance gas exchange in your small pond. Also, use a test kit to accurately measure oxygen levels. Test regularly, especially during periods of warm weather, to make sure your small fish pond has enough oxygen for healthy fish.
